Nobody is suggesting Marquez "tripped" him. Marquez had his lead foot set well before Pacquiao came forward off balance and out of position, the same thing has happened frequently in all of their fights as Inuit said. It doesn't detract from Marquez' win to attribute it to better footwork and patience, surely..Manny tripped up because he came in wide open at the wrong moment, not the other way around.

If you look at what happens to Pacs hands mid way, they go from the usual delivering a jab reaction, with possibly a followup left, to one of natural reaction to falling. Think about the human reaction to falling. Both hands tend to pull up almost 100% of the time to protect the head for when it hits the ground. It's not something someone chooses to do, it just happens.
